Shinshu international music village is built as a place of interchange
and social education facility for cultivating a rich mind as a trigger,
with music and art as one opportunity.
Facilities in the park include 4,323 square meters of lawn open space,
Observation square, promenade, flower garden and so on.
Flower fields are popular with lavender and daffodil. "Suishen festival"
is held every year from late March to mid April. Lavender has its best
appearance every year from early July to mid July. Also, the experience
of making lavender sticks is popular.
Facilities of music include indoor hall "Kodama", outdoor hall
"Hibiki", fees are charged for using the music facility. |
